精通 Vue 全家桶(vue + vue-cli + vue-router + vuex + axios)
熟练使用 uni-app 框架开发,可以配合组件库进行多端开发及打包项目
熟练使用 Git 版本控制工具,掌握 vite、vue-cli、webpack 等项目构建工具的使用
熟练使用 HTML5 语义化标签、CSS3 新特性、Es6 语法
熟练微信小程序开发流程和相关技术,具有一定的开发经验
熟练使用 ant-design、vant,elementUI,echarts 等 UI 组件库
掌握 react、react-router-dom、redux,能够结合相应的 UI 组件库进行项目开发
掌握 sass、less 的基础语法, 熟悉 typeScript 的基础语法
掌握 mysql、mangodb 数据库的基础语法(增删改查)
掌握 nodejs,mock 的基本使用
项目一:楼先生房源管理系统
技术栈:vue2、vue-cli、element-ui、vuex、vue-router、axios、echarts 等
项目描述:该系业绩管理、用户管理,交易管理等,可以帮助用户实时统是一个用于公司内部房源的管理系统,内置有房源管理、观看到房源的情况概览和交易记录。
负责模块:业绩统计排名、权限管理、房源管理,用户管理。
技术要点:
1、使用 ECharts 实现数据可视化,使用户更直观的看到数据的变化趋势;
2、使用高德地图组件实现房源信息的可视化。
3、使用动态路由完成权限控制,使不同角色登录只能看到对应的菜单和路由权限。
4、使用路由懒加载、element-ui 的按需引入、图片懒加载进行项目的优化。
5、使用 axios 请求响应拦截器添加 token 和判断 token 是否有效。
项目二:楼先生官网
技术栈:Vue2、vue-cli、element-ui、Vuex、vue-Router、axios 等
项目描述:该网站是为公司官网,主要展示了新闻咨询、合作业主、合作渠道、合作项目等。负责模块:首页动画效果的实现、数据渲染、各个模块的封装。
技术要点:
1、首页采用节流+动态 class 实现首页动画效果;
2、使用 Vuex 对全局数据状态进行动态管理;
3、通过路由的懒加载、element-ui 的按需引入对项目打开速度进行优化;
4、对相同模块和函数进行封装、减少代码量,提高开发效率;
5、统一 api 接口管理、便于编程人员配置接口地址或修改、便于管理;
楼先生在上海于2017年6月创立,公司致力于成为办公楼生态运营服务商,依托于线上营销工具楼先生APP,创新业主线上营销、联合体招商代理及托管运营服务模式,打造连接物业持有者与渠道合作及满足用户需求的信用桥梁,解决办公楼高效去化问题。
项目描述:该项目是基于 uniapp 开发打包的一个写字楼、房产出租出售平台,用户可以根据楼盘类型、地理位置和价位预算一键匹配到合适的房源,或者在平台进行房源委托发布。 负责模块:用户访问权限,出租出售模块的渲染,首页轮播图和房源详细信息 技术要点: 1、利用 uview-